Few topics spark more passionate debate on Staten Island than pizza.
To launch our new Community Favorites series, we asked members of the Staten Island Neighbors community a simple question:
Who has the best pizza on Staten Island?
Hundreds of residents shared their recommendations, highlighting longtime neighborhood institutions, family-owned pizzerias, and hidden gems across the borough. While there was no unanimous winner, several restaurants stood out with repeated recommendations from community members.
Whether you’re searching for a classic New York-style slice, a crispy tavern pie, a Sicilian square, or a specialty pie, these are some of the pizza spots Staten Islanders recommended most.
Community Favorites
🍕 Denino’s Pizzeria & Tavern
A Staten Island institution for generations, Denino’s was one of the community’s most frequently recommended pizzerias. Many residents praised its classic thin-crust pies and traditional pizzeria experience.
🍕 Brothers Pizzeria
Brothers received an overwhelming number of recommendations, with many community members specifically mentioning its popular Sicilian pizza.
🍕 Lee’s Tavern
Known for its famous tavern-style pizzas, Lee’s Tavern continues to be a longtime favorite among Staten Islanders and was one of the most frequently mentioned businesses in our community discussion.
🍕 Joe & Pat’s Pizzeria
A neighborhood staple with a loyal following, Joe & Pat’s was repeatedly recommended for its classic New York-style pizza.
🍕 Pizza Giove
One of the newer favorites to emerge in recent years, Pizza Giove earned numerous recommendations from residents throughout the community.
🍕 Ciro’s
Ciro’s received consistent praise from community members, with many calling it one of Staten Island’s best-kept pizza traditions.
🍕 Jimmy Max
Known for its specialty pies as well as traditional pizza, Jimmy Max was another business frequently recommended by residents.
🍕 Round Pie Pizza Company
Round Pie appeared throughout the discussion, with many residents praising its unique style and quality.
🍕 Nonna’s Pizzeria
Nonna’s earned repeated recommendations from community members, particularly those on the South Shore.
🍕 Campania
Campania rounded out many residents’ personal top lists and continues to be one of Staten Island’s most talked-about pizzerias.
